李瑞江
(新疆輕工職業(yè)技術(shù)學(xué)院 新疆 烏魯木齊830021)
對于信息量多,管理相對復(fù)雜的數(shù)據(jù)采用信息化處理不僅能夠提高效率,方便管理,也能節(jié)省很多資源,學(xué)生綜合素質(zhì)信息的管理工作無疑符合以上的要求。學(xué)生管理部門通過綜合素質(zhì)測評,掌握大學(xué)生在校期間德、智、體等方面的表現(xiàn)情況,測評結(jié)果常作為學(xué)生評優(yōu)評獎(jiǎng)、推薦就業(yè)的主要依據(jù),同時(shí)也是學(xué)生推優(yōu)入黨的一個(gè)重要依據(jù)[1]。
當(dāng)前高職院校經(jīng)歷了一個(gè)快速成長期,由于各高職院校的辦學(xué)特色及學(xué)生情況不盡相同,所以針對學(xué)生的綜合素質(zhì)評定的指標(biāo)也不盡相同[2-3],目前針對高職院校的學(xué)生綜合素質(zhì)評定軟件也為數(shù)不多,軟件缺乏可重用性,程序不夠健壯。因此,開發(fā)設(shè)計(jì)出學(xué)生綜合素質(zhì)統(tǒng)一管理系統(tǒng)是一個(gè)極具價(jià)值而且必要的項(xiàng)目。這樣的系統(tǒng)實(shí)現(xiàn)了量化學(xué)生素質(zhì)評價(jià)標(biāo)準(zhǔn),體現(xiàn)了科學(xué)有效的評價(jià)學(xué)生素質(zhì)的要求。通過清晰的量化數(shù)據(jù),幫助班主任掌握班級學(xué)生情況,避免主觀印象評價(jià)學(xué)生。通過動態(tài)跟蹤學(xué)生素質(zhì)變化數(shù)據(jù),有助于班主任及時(shí)掌握學(xué)生情況,有助于學(xué)校改進(jìn)管理手段。
每個(gè)學(xué)生的綜合素質(zhì)評價(jià)標(biāo)準(zhǔn)由 “班級評定 (占50%)”、“系部評定(占 30%)”、“學(xué)院評定(占 20%)”3 個(gè)部分組成,每個(gè)部分按照百分制計(jì)算,最后按所占比例折算后相加形成最后的評價(jià)得分。
本項(xiàng)目開展工作直接有關(guān)的人員和用戶為:全體教職工、班主任、主管學(xué)生工作系部主任、學(xué)生處管理人員、系統(tǒng)管理員。
1)登錄驗(yàn)證
權(quán)限用戶:所有用戶
所有用戶必須登錄,才能進(jìn)行使用系統(tǒng),才能進(jìn)行權(quán)限范圍內(nèi)的操作。
2)班級評定信息錄入與編輯
權(quán)限用戶:班主任
班主任登錄系統(tǒng)后完成班級評定部分的信息錄入與編輯工作。班級評定信息一般一個(gè)學(xué)期后根據(jù)每個(gè)學(xué)生總體表現(xiàn)由班主任進(jìn)行評定,班級評定部分的編輯工作也只能有班主任完成。
3)系部評定信息錄入與編輯
權(quán)限用戶:系部主任
系部主任登錄系統(tǒng)后完成所在系的系部評定部分的信息錄入與編輯工作。一般一個(gè)學(xué)期后根據(jù)每個(gè)學(xué)生總體表現(xiàn)由學(xué)生所在的系部主任進(jìn)行評定,系部評定部分的編輯工作只能由學(xué)生所在的系部主任完成。
4)學(xué)院評定信息錄入與編輯
權(quán)限用戶:學(xué)生處管理人員
學(xué)生處管理人員登錄系統(tǒng)后完成學(xué)院評定部分的信息錄入與編輯。一般一個(gè)學(xué)期后根據(jù)每個(gè)學(xué)生總體表現(xiàn)由學(xué)生處管理人員進(jìn)行評定,學(xué)院評定部分的編輯工作也只能由學(xué)生處管理人員完成。
5)班級學(xué)生綜合素質(zhì)大項(xiàng)查詢
權(quán)限用戶:所有用戶
所有用戶登錄系統(tǒng)后,可以查詢各個(gè)班級學(xué)生的大項(xiàng)綜合素質(zhì)信息。
6)個(gè)體學(xué)生綜合素質(zhì)小項(xiàng)查詢
權(quán)限用戶:所有用戶
所有用戶登錄系統(tǒng)后,可以查詢各個(gè)學(xué)生的小項(xiàng)綜合素質(zhì)詳細(xì)信息。
7)用戶角色和權(quán)限設(shè)置
權(quán)限用戶:系統(tǒng)管理員
系統(tǒng)管理員登錄系統(tǒng)后,設(shè)置全體教師、班主任、系部主任、學(xué)生處管理人員的角色和權(quán)限。
系統(tǒng)以學(xué)生綜合素質(zhì)的信息管理為核心內(nèi)容,整個(gè)系統(tǒng)包含角色管理、學(xué)生綜合素質(zhì)信息錄入、學(xué)生綜合素質(zhì)信息編輯、學(xué)生綜合素質(zhì)信息查詢4個(gè)功能模塊,具體如圖1所示。
圖1 學(xué)生綜合素質(zhì)統(tǒng)一管理平臺功能模塊圖Fig.1 The functionmodule of students'comprehensive quality and unifiedmanagement platform
本系統(tǒng)應(yīng)具有以下特點(diǎn):1)靈活性和實(shí)用性:學(xué)生綜合素質(zhì)評價(jià)標(biāo)準(zhǔn)可能隨著學(xué)校和社會的發(fā)展而發(fā)生變化,所以系統(tǒng)設(shè)計(jì)時(shí)應(yīng)考慮此點(diǎn),提供重新設(shè)定評價(jià)項(xiàng)目和單項(xiàng)分值的功能;2)簡便性:能適用于不同計(jì)算機(jī)應(yīng)用水平的用戶;3)安全性:保證評價(jià)數(shù)據(jù)的正確性、完整性和可用性,防御非法用戶對數(shù)據(jù)進(jìn)行竊取和破壞;4)開放性:系統(tǒng)面向在校的所有教師和學(xué)生,是學(xué)院信息化系統(tǒng)的一個(gè)組成部分。
綜合考慮系統(tǒng)對性能、安全性及快速開發(fā)等要求,服務(wù)器的操作系統(tǒng)選擇Windows Server 2008,安裝.NET Framework4.0,Web服務(wù)器為 Internet Information Services 7.0(IIS7.0),基于對數(shù)據(jù)安全性和可恢復(fù)性的考慮,后臺數(shù)據(jù)庫選擇使用SQL Server 2008和SQL Server 2008 Express。
為實(shí)現(xiàn)系統(tǒng)功能需求分析所述的功能,共設(shè)計(jì)了6個(gè)數(shù)據(jù)表
管理員表SQM_Admin
學(xué)院評分表SQM_SchoolScore
系部評分表SQM_DepartmentScore
班級評分表SQM_ClassScore
評分表SQM_Score
角色表SQM_Roles
另外,需要使用學(xué)院信息系統(tǒng)的數(shù)據(jù)庫的原有的基本數(shù)據(jù)表包括:
年級表tc_graded
班級類型表tc_classType
系(部)表 tc_department
專業(yè)表tc_object
學(xué)院班級表tuClassList
學(xué)生表tustudentlist
本系統(tǒng)采用ASP.NET的Form身份驗(yàn)證方式和基于角色的訪問控制 RBAC(Role-Based Access Control)。 RBAC是關(guān)于用戶、角色和權(quán)限的理論模型,其基本思想是:將權(quán)限分配給角色,將用戶按角色劃分,通過角色把用戶和權(quán)限聯(lián)邦系起來,只有當(dāng)某個(gè)用戶屬于某個(gè)角色時(shí),它才可以訪問這個(gè)角色所擁有的權(quán)限[4]。
系統(tǒng)共分為管理員、班主任、系部主任、學(xué)生處管理人員、全體教職工5個(gè)角色,各種角色具有相應(yīng)的權(quán)限。
1)全體教職工:學(xué)院所有教職工均可查看所有班級和學(xué)生個(gè)人的綜合素質(zhì)信息。
2)班主任:本班學(xué)生綜合素質(zhì)中班級評定部分的數(shù)據(jù)錄入與編輯。
3)系部主任:本系所有學(xué)生綜合素質(zhì)中系部評定部分的數(shù)據(jù)錄入與編輯;本系所有班主任的權(quán)限設(shè)置與管理;班主任權(quán)限設(shè)置與管理。
4)學(xué)生處管理人員:全校所有學(xué)生綜合素質(zhì)中學(xué)院評定部分的數(shù)據(jù)錄入與編輯。
5)管理員:全體教職工權(quán)限設(shè)置與管理;系部主任權(quán)限設(shè)置與管理;學(xué)生處管理人員權(quán)限設(shè)置與管理。
基于本系統(tǒng)的用戶特點(diǎn)和規(guī)模及安全性要求,系統(tǒng)開發(fā)采用Microsoft的ASP.NET開發(fā)技術(shù),網(wǎng)站的界面設(shè)計(jì)的做到簡潔友好、便于操作。開發(fā)主要由Visual Studio 2010中的VisualWeb Develop(簡稱VWD)來實(shí)現(xiàn),在VWD的協(xié)助下,ASP.NET具有一些用于設(shè)計(jì)和布局的強(qiáng)大工具,網(wǎng)頁上數(shù)據(jù)的輸入和顯示主要使用標(biāo)準(zhǔn)Web服務(wù)器控件和用戶自定義的控件。
開發(fā)過程采用快速開發(fā)模式,把數(shù)據(jù)源控件和數(shù)據(jù)顯示控件相結(jié)合進(jìn)行開發(fā),數(shù)據(jù)源控件用來操作數(shù)據(jù)庫的數(shù)據(jù),數(shù)據(jù)顯示控件把數(shù)據(jù)源控件取得的數(shù)據(jù)以不同的界面方式顯示出來,這是一種優(yōu)秀的編程方式。這種快速開發(fā)模式,數(shù)據(jù)庫操作語句是開發(fā)工具自動產(chǎn)生的,開發(fā)人員在開發(fā)程序時(shí)不需要手工編寫新增、修改、查詢、刪除的SQL語句,這樣可以大大縮短開發(fā)時(shí)間[5]。
系統(tǒng)服務(wù)器部署在學(xué)院計(jì)算機(jī)中心機(jī)房的HP BL460 G7刀片服務(wù)器上并在校園網(wǎng)站主頁建立超鏈接,組織教師和學(xué)生在校園內(nèi)和校園外分別進(jìn)行測試直到達(dá)到設(shè)計(jì)要求。
圖2 系統(tǒng)首頁Fig.2 home page of the system
學(xué)生綜合素質(zhì)評價(jià)在是教育過程中的一個(gè)重要環(huán)節(jié),對于學(xué)生確定發(fā)展方向,提高綜合素質(zhì)有重要的導(dǎo)向作用[6]。
文中在學(xué)生綜合素質(zhì)評價(jià)標(biāo)準(zhǔn)基礎(chǔ)上對整個(gè)評價(jià)系統(tǒng)進(jìn)行整體的設(shè)計(jì)和實(shí)現(xiàn)。該系統(tǒng)在學(xué)生綜合素質(zhì)評價(jià)中能使評價(jià)的更加的公正、公平和公正,使評價(jià)的客觀性有了很大的保證,能夠較快的得出評價(jià)結(jié)果,減輕大學(xué)生綜合素質(zhì)評價(jià)工作的勞動強(qiáng)度,而且能及時(shí)向?qū)W生反饋信息,充分發(fā)揮了評價(jià)意見對學(xué)生的指導(dǎo)作用,同時(shí)也為教育者制定和調(diào)整教育決策提供依據(jù),具備一定的實(shí)用價(jià)值。當(dāng)然在如何對學(xué)生職業(yè)素質(zhì)進(jìn)行全面客觀的評價(jià)時(shí),需要根據(jù)各學(xué)校根據(jù)實(shí)際情況,將量化與非量化的評價(jià)有機(jī)地結(jié)合起來,并在實(shí)踐中不斷歸納和總結(jié)。
[1]黃會明,陳寧,嚴(yán)小明,等.應(yīng)用AHP與TOPSIS法評價(jià)高職學(xué)生綜合素質(zhì)[J].職業(yè)技術(shù)教育,2009,30(13):46-49.HUANG Hui-ming,CHEN Ning,YAN Xiao-ming,et al.Assessment of higher vocational college students’comprehensive quality based on AHP and TOPSISmethods[J].Vocational and Technical Education,2009,30(13):46-49.
[2]李艷紅,李默涵.高校師生從教技能訓(xùn)練水平的模糊綜合評判[J].遼東學(xué)院學(xué)報(bào):自然科學(xué)版,2011,18(3):251—254.LI Yan-hong,LI Mo-han.Teaching skill training level of higher normal school students:a fuzzy comprehensive evaluation method[J].Journal of Liaodong University:Natural Sciences,2011,18(3):251-254.
[3]劉瀟,張莉.基于AHP的教師教學(xué)質(zhì)量評價(jià)體系[J].遼東學(xué)院學(xué)報(bào): 自然科學(xué)版,2011,18(3):246—250.LIU Xiao,ZHANG Li.AHP-based teaching quality evaluation system[J].Journal of Liaodong University:Natural Sciences,2011,18(3):246-250.
[4]Sandhu R,Bhamidipati V,Munawer Q.The ARBAC97 model for role-based administration of roles[J].ACM Transactions on Information and System Security,1999,2(1):105-135.
[5]王海生,萬慶平,陳建榮.Web數(shù)據(jù)庫系統(tǒng)快速開發(fā)模式的研究[J].計(jì)算機(jī)應(yīng)用與軟件,2012,29(2):179-182.WANG Hai-sheng,WAN Qing-ping,CHEN Jianrong.Study on Web database system rapid development mode[J].Computer Application and Software,2012,29(2):179-182.
[6]申瑋.基于Web大學(xué)生綜合素質(zhì)評價(jià)的研究 [J].福建電腦,2012,4(1):64-66.ShenWei.The Study of the College Students'Comprehensive Quality Evaluation Based on Web[J].Journal of Fujian,2012,4(1):64-66.